Leaf DifferenceThe leaves of French holly are leathery, elliptical, obovate or obovate, sometimes nearly round, about 7 to 20 cm long, with a short or gradually pointed apex, a broad cuneate base, vaguely nearly round, and irregular, shallowly wavy serrations on the edges of the leaves. The leaves are dark green and shiny above, and glabrous on both sides. Holly leaves are simple, alternate and vaguely opposite. The leaves are leathery, papery or membranous, oblong, ovate, elliptical or lanceolate. The leaf surface is green and shiny, and the back is light green. 2. Flower DifferencesThe French holly panicle inflorescence grows at the terminal or on short lateral branches, 6 to 13.5 cm long and 4.5 to 6 cm wide, with a white corolla that later turns yellowish white. Holly flowers are cymes or umbels, the inflorescences are solitary in the axils of the current year's branches, or clustered in the axils of the two-year-old branches. The flowers are small and white, pink or red. |
